Imperial County members have participated in a strong grassroots coalition to den y a proposal by Wind Zer o Group , Inc, to develop a paramilitary training camp on a 944-acr e patch of desert which is in a flood and earthquake zone, just south o f a major Interstate Highway (I-8), and less than a dozen miles north o f the Me xican border. They argue it poses a great risk to the health of the environment a s well a s the safety o f the sur- rounding community . Special concerns are air pollution, ground water depletion and colossal dis rupti on of the quiet desert community . The Hi Sierran cost s us almost $30,000 per year t o produce , print, and mail. That is about $2.50 pe r subsc riber per year. W e incl uded a reply coupon asking members to tell us whether they wanted to continue gettin g a paper copy, or would read the Hi Sierran online. About 40 0 members responded. Less th an 100 of the r espon- ders asked to continue get ting a paper copy , the rest opted to read the Hi Sierran online. Some of you sen t donations, totalling almost $1,000 from 58 people. There wer e a few lar ge donat ions, and ma ny small ones . Than ks to all o f you who responded. Unfortunate ly, 400 members is less than four percent of our member ship . In other words,most memb ers did not re spond. This may be further evidence that many members are not read- ing the paper copy or are not sufficiently concerned to respond to our appeal for input. This year , we will be taking a different approach. Y ou MUST reply in order to co ntin ue getti ng a paper cop y . Lack of a reply will be interpreted as an opt-out. Only th ose who re ply , or have already replied, will be kept on our maili ng list for the paper edition. Introduction to CEQA & NEPA Two-Day Workshop Saturda y Marc h, 12th and Saturday Marc h, 19th 10am to 4 pm 8304 Claire mont Mesa Blvd, Suite TBA S an Diego, California 92111 Description: This two-day workshop will provide an applied overview of the California Enviro nmental Quality A ct and the Nationa l Environmen tal Policy Act with an emphasis on drafting effective public comments. Starti ng with a brief back grou nd of environmental imp act assessments in the U .S. and a review of CEQA a nd NEP A's regulato ry context, the workshop will discuss the various approaches used in scop- ing and preparing environmental impact reports under both statutes. The documents required under CEQA/NEPA will be examined and the roles of key pla yers explor ed.
